What should I look for when picking a land clearing company in Russellville?
Compare recent before/after photos on terrain like yours, the equipment the crew runs (a purpose-built forestry mulcher on a tracked carrier — Fecon, FAE, CAT, ASV — handles more than a rented brush cutter), proof of insurance, and whether they price per acre or by the day. Verified reviews and photos of finished ground are the strongest signals of quality work.
